Practical tips before hiring SCALA Real Estate Design
To make the most of a consultation with SCALA, prospective clients should gather existing property documents, an outline of intended changes (for example an ADU conversion or bathroom addition), and a realistic budget range. Since office hours are not published, it is advisable to request an appointment in advance; many clients reported that the studio coordinated well with city departments and contractors, so early engagement helps speed the permit process.
Other useful considerations include the following:
- Plan to book consultations early in the project timeline to allow sufficient time for permits and contractor bids.
- Ask for a projected schedule and milestones so the timeline for design and permits is clear.
- Confirm communication preferences—email and text were cited as effective by past clients.
- Discuss expectations about deliverables, such as permit-ready plans and any construction administration support.
